Meeting notes — Fan-out backpressure (excerpt)

Discussed recurring queue buildup in the Larkspur notification fan-out service during peak broadcast windows. Agreed to cap per-tenant fan-out at 5k recipients per batch and enable the token-bucket throttle by default. Future maintainers should note the throttle config lives in the dispatcher tier, not the gateway, and changing it requires a rolling restart. Open question on dead-letter retention deferred to next review. Decisions above were approved by the engineer named below.

signatory, bahaf-hawip: Rusix Sorir Drumir Belius

## Who to ping about GiftNote

Welcome aboard! GiftNote is our donation-receipt mailer for the Larchfield Fund. Template tweaks go to the comms folks; delivery failures and bounce weirdness go to the platform crew. Don't push template changes on Fridays — receipts batch over the weekend. For anything GiftNote-related, start with the address below.

billing contact of kaweg-tajeg = drudor.lamion.oliath@torvalabs.test

### Runbook: Report export timezone mismatches (Glimmerfield)

If a customer reports that exported totals differ from the dashboard, check whether their report schedule predates the March cutover — older schedules still render in server-local time rather than the account timezone. Re-saving the schedule fixes it. Before escalating, confirm the export worker is running with the expected timezone settings shown below.

config for kadup-kajog:
[raldor]
host = raldor.tolvaqworks.internal
user = raldor_svc
database = raldor_prod